Digital Twin Specialist
A Digital Twin Specialist in architecture focuses on creating and managing digital replicas of physical structures. This role involves using advanced technology to enhance design, construction, and maintenance processes.

View related coursesDay-to-day tasks
Daily tasks may involve:
- Developing and updating digital twin models
- Collaborating with architects and engineers
- Conducting data analysis to inform design decisions
- Ensuring data accuracy and integrity
- Presenting findings to stakeholders
- Implementing sustainability measures in designs
- Troubleshooting technical issues
Skills needed
Key skills for a Digital Twin Specialist include:
- Technical proficiency in software tools
- Data analysis and interpretation
- Strong communication skills
- Problem-solving abilities
- Project management
- Attention to detail
- Collaboration with multidisciplinary teams
Career progression
A career as a Digital Twin Specialist can lead to roles such as Senior Architect, BIM Manager, or Project Lead. Continuous learning and staying updated with technology trends are crucial for advancement in this field.
